On generalized hyperinterpolation on the sphere

Author(s): Feng Dai
Journal: Proc. Amer. Math. Soc. 134 (2006), 2931-2941.

Abstract: It is shown that second-order results can be attained by the generalized hyperinterpolation operators on the sphere, which gives an affirmative answer to a question raised by Reimer in Constr. Approx. 18(2002), no. 2, 183-203.
